Idea or Mind Mapping

A mind map is a diagram used to visually organize information.  It is hierarchical and shows relationships among pieces of the whole. Wikipedia

Idea or mind mapping is a visual approach to representing ideas and concepts.  It is a graphical technique for visualizing connections between several ideas or pieces of information.  Proponents of this system believe that it helps one think, collect knowledge, remember, and analyze information.

Some use idea or mind mapping in conjunction with brainstorming to capture and write down new or related ideas that radiate from a central idea or concept.

To create an idea or mind map, write down the central theme or idea in the center of a blank page or wall chart.  From that point work outwards in all directions to create an evolving diagram of keywords, phrases, concepts, and facts using lines, arrows, branches, and colors to show the relationship stemming from the central idea or concept.
